We are looking for a School Nurse to join us from September 2026.

In this role, you will:

  • Provide emergency care, first aid and immediate treatment to pupils, staff and visitors, ensuring a timely and appropriate response to medical incidents.
  • Administer medications and implement individual healthcare/welfare plans, including safe management and recording of controlled drugs in line with regulatory requirements.

How to prepare for a job interview at Pilgrims' School

Know Your Medical Protocols

Familiarise yourself with common medical protocols and emergency procedures relevant to a school environment. This will not only show your expertise but also demonstrate your readiness to handle medical incidents effectively.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ect scenario-based questions where you might need to explain how you'd handle specific medical situations. Practising these scenarios can help you articulate your thought process and decision-making skills during the interview.

Highlight Your Communication Skills

As a School Nurse, you'll need to communicate effectively with pupils, staff, and parents. Be ready to share examples of how you've successfully communicated in past roles, especially in sensitive situations.

Show Your Passion for Student Welfare

Demonstrate your commitment to student health and welfare.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that highlight your dedication to creating a safe and supportive environment for students.
